Childress Municipal Airport (CDS): Codes, Runways & Location
Childress Municipal Airport (IATA: CDS · ICAO: KCDS) is a medium-sized airport serving Childress, United States. It lies at 34.4338° N, 100.2880° W, 1954 ft (596 m) above sea level.
Overview of Childress Municipal Airport
Childress Municipal Airport is classified in the OurAirports dataset as a medium-sized airport, serving the area of Childress in United States. It is identified by the IATA code CDS and the ICAO code KCDS. It is not recorded as having scheduled commercial airline service, so it mainly serves general, charter or regional aviation.
Childress Municipal Airport has 2 runways recorded. Its longest runway is about 1813 m (5949 ft) long. A runway of that length can physically support narrow-body jets such as the Airbus A320 and Boeing 737 families, though actual limits also depend on elevation, temperature, payload and local procedures. Runway surface: asphalt. At least one runway has lighting for night operations. The field elevation is 1954 ft (596 m); higher-elevation airports need longer takeoff runs in thin air.
Other airports lie nearby: 6 are within reach, the closest being Altus Quartz Mountain Regional Airport (AXS) about 92 km away.
